Output de42a895a0b09bc9387c34e407c912885727eb00baf65db4b754464a4a1f3d74:21

value
1595623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dcc8eb72df5af85ddfa9b55232898fed0006fc5 OP_EQUAL
address
3BhadMcwo2Z77Lq5jQnXbbCEpmASfZKNit
transaction
de42a895a0b09bc9387c34e407c912885727eb00baf65db4b754464a4a1f3d74
spent
true